Abstract

This paper presents a suitability analysis of silicon carbide diodes in buck converters with high input voltage and high voltage conversion ratio functional requirements. It provides a comparison of a conventional buck converter with silicon carbide diodes and ultrafast silicon diodes, illustrating the benefits of silicon carbide diode zero reverse-recovery losses. Experimental results are provided for a 768W prototype. © 2008 IEEE.
